Ingredients for avocado toast recipe
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Ripe Avocados: Choose avocados that yield slightly when pressed gently; they should feel soft but not mushy.
- Bread of Choice: Opt for whole grain or sourdough for added flavor and nutrition; feel free to use gluten-free options too.
- Lemon Juice: Freshly squeezed lemon juice adds brightness and helps prevent the avocado from browning.
- Salt and Pepper: Essential seasonings that elevate the dish’s flavor; flaky sea salt works wonders here.
- Optional Toppings: Think cherry tomatoes, radishes, poached eggs, or even chili flakes for an extra kick.

How to Make avocado toast recipe
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Toast Your Bread
Start by popping your bread into the toaster until it’s golden brown and slightly crispy. If you’re feeling fancy, you can also grill it on a skillet over medium heat with a drizzle of olive oil.
Step 2: Prepare the Avocado
Cut the ripe avocados in half, remove the pit (carefully—this isn’t an extreme sport), and scoop the green goodness into a bowl. Mash it lightly with a fork until creamy but still chunky enough to make you feel like you did something productive.
Step 3: Season It Up
Add freshly squeezed lemon juice along with salt and pepper to taste. Mix well! This is where the magic happens—the flavors start dancing together like they’re auditioning for “Dancing with the Stars.”
Step 4: Spread It On
Once your bread is toasted to perfection, generously spread your mashed avocado on top. Don’t be shy—this isn’t a time for dainty portions! Think of it as creating a beautiful canvas for your culinary masterpiece.
Step 5: Add Toppings
Here comes the fun part! Top your creation with whatever tickles your fancy—sliced cherry tomatoes for freshness, radish slices for crunch, or even a perfectly poached egg if you’re feeling gourmet.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y

Storing & Reheating
Avocado toast is best enjoyed fresh, but if you have leftovers, store the components separately in airtight containers. Toast can be reheated in a toaster or oven until crispy again, but keep toppings aside until serving.

FAQs:
What is the best bread for an avocado toast recipe?
Selecting the right bread can elevate your avocado toast. Whole grain and sourdough are popular choices due to their hearty texture and flavor. These options complement the creamy avocado well, providing a satisfying crunch. Gluten-free bread can be used if you have dietary restrictions. Ultimately, it comes down to personal preference, so experiment with different types to find your favorite.
How can I make my avocado toast recipe more flavorful?
To enhance the flavor of your avocado toast, consider adding toppings like cherry tomatoes, radishes, or a sprinkle of feta cheese. Fresh herbs such as cilantro or basil also add a vibrant touch. A drizzle of olive oil or balsamic glaze can give it a gourmet finish. Don’t forget seasoning; salt and pepper are essentials, but red pepper flakes can add a nice kick.
Can I prepare the avocado in advance for my avocado toast recipe?
Yes, you can prepare avocados in advance, but they brown quickly once cut. To keep them fresh, store the mashed or sliced avocado in an airtight container with lime or lemon juice. This acidity slows down browning. However, it’s best to assemble your toast just before eating to maintain its freshness and texture.
Is avocado toast a healthy breakfast option?
Absolutely! Avocado toast is packed with healthy fats from avocados, which support heart health. It also offers fiber that aids digestion. When made with whole grain bread, it provides essential nutrients and energy for your day. Pairing it with protein-rich toppings like eggs or smoked salmon can further enhance its nutritional benefits.

Avocado Toast
- Total Time: 10 minutes
- Yield: This recipe yields 2 servings.
Description
Savor creamy ripe avocados on crispy toast, topped with fresh ingredients for a delightful breakfast or snack. Perfect for any time of day!
Ingredients
- Key Ingredients
- 2 ripe avocados
- 2 slices whole grain or sourdough bread
- 1 tbsp freshly squeezed l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Optional toppings: cherry tomatoes, radishes, poached eggs, chili flakes
Instructions
- Instructions
- 1. Toast Your Bread: Toast the slices until golden brown and crispy. Alternatively, grill on medium heat with a drizzle of olive oil for added flavor.
- 2. Prepare the Avocado: Halve the ripe avocados, remove the pit, and scoop the flesh into a bowl. Mash lightly with a fork until creamy yet chunky.
- 3. Season It Up: Mix in freshly squeezed lemon juice along with salt and pepper to taste, ensuring even distribution for maximum flavor.
- 4. Spread It On: Generously spread the mashed avocado onto toasted bread, creating an inviting base for your toppings.
- 5. Add Toppings: Customize your toast by adding sliced cherry tomatoes, radish slices, or a poached egg for an extra layer of flavor.
- 6. Serve and Enjoy: Plate your avocado toast or enjoy it straight from the cutting board. Take a moment to snap a picture before diving in!
- Prep Time: 5 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Category: Breakfast/Snack
- Method: Toasting
- Cuisine: American
Nutrition
- Serving Size: 1 serving
- Calories: 320
- Sugar: 1g
- Sodium: 200mg
- Fat: 18g
- Saturated Fat: 2g
- Unsaturated Fat: 16g
- Trans Fat: 0g
- Carbohydrates: 32g
- Fiber: 10g
- Protein: 6g
- Cholesterol: 0mg
